Output 83bc1f026bf0bf9569213aa3efa59773e067cfdc1b4c2cd0bb2de5a197c29f42:1

value
143276
script pubkey
OP_0 OP_PUSHBYTES_20 17758f21cd4bbbdf927e6e0104ccc81bbb926a97
address
bc1qza6c7gwdfwaalyn7dcqsfnxgrwaey65hu6f538
transaction
83bc1f026bf0bf9569213aa3efa59773e067cfdc1b4c2cd0bb2de5a197c29f42
confirmations
119115
spent
true